ABC's "Dancing with the Stars" and "Castle" Jump by Double Digits Week to Week
ABC spins the numbers for Monday, May 12.

[via press release from ABC]

ABC's "Dancing with the Stars" and "Castle" Jump by Double Digits Week to Week

ABC Monday Prime (8-11pm - 12.7 million and 2.1/6 in AD18-49): ABC finished as Monday's most-watched TV network for the 5th week running, outdrawing runner-up NBC by 18% (12.7 million vs. 10.8 million). In addition, the Net took 2nd on the night in Adults 18-49 (2.1/6), beating Fox with Bones and 24: Live Another Day by 17% (1.8/5) and CBS' lineup by 62% (1.3/4). ABC was the only net up over the prior Monday, as Dancing and Castle spiked week-to-week in Adults 18-49, surging 16% and 25%, respectively. ABC's Dancing with the Stars semi-finals was the night's most-watched TV program overall.

Dancing with the Stars (8-10pm - 13.8 million and 2.2/6 in AD18-49): From 8-10pm, ABC's DWTS stood as the night's most-watched TV series for the 9th week in a row, topping NBC's The Voice head to head by 2.9 million viewers (13.8 vs. 10.9 million).

· Dancing grew week to week in viewers (+5%) and young adults (+16%). In addition, DWTS was up over the same night last year (05/13/13) in Total Viewers (+4%) and Adults 18-49 (+10%), building year to year for the 6th time in its last 7 telecasts.

Castle (10-11pm - 10.4 million and 2.0/6 in AD18-49): During the 10 o'clock hour, ABC's season finale of Castle shot up week to week in Total Viewers (+16%) and Adults 18-49 (+25%), equaling a 14-week high with young adults - since 2/3/14. The ABC drama ranked #1 in the hour with Adults 18-34 (tie) and Women 18-34, posting its best numbers since November - since 11/4/13.

· On average this season, Castle was up in Total Viewers (+3%) and Adults 18-49 (+4%), marking the series' most-watched season overall.

A note about increasing DVR penetration and year-to-year rating comparisons: Year-to-year rating comparisons based on the Live + Same Day data stream are distorted by the level of DVR penetration in the Nielsen sample, which has jumped up to 49% currently, from 47% at the same point in 2013. More viewers are watching shows on their own timetables, which may not be reflected in the overnight next day numbers. The only truly valid year-to-year comparison would be one based on the Live + 7 Day metric, once those stats are released by Nielsen.
